Visual proof of well condition
Our downhole camera inspections show the true condition of casing, joints, and screens instead of relying only on assumptions or surface symptoms. High‑quality footage makes it easy to spot corrosion, collapsed sections, scale buildup, or obstructions so you know exactly what you are dealing with before you spend money in the wrong place. Depth‑referenced footage your crew can use
Video is recorded with clear depth references, giving your drillers and pump crews precise locations for problems such as holes, breaks, or plugged intervals. That means rehab work, patching, or screen replacements can be targeted to the exact footage instead of trial‑and‑error efforts that waste rig time.
Quick turnaround for urgent issues
When a production or municipal well is down, you cannot wait weeks for information. We prioritize fast scheduling and simple file delivery so your team can review footage the same day and decide whether to clean, rehab, or plan a new well without dragging out downtime.
Documentation that supports your recommendations
Well video inspections provide powerful visual evidence you can share with owners, engineers, and regulators to justify your proposed work. Clear clips and still images help explain why a rehab is needed, why a well should be taken out of service, or how previous construction has failed, protecting both your reputation and your client’s investment.
